Serbia, Kingdom. An Order of the White Eagle, V Class Knight, c. 1917 Auction topped by a suspension loopInstituted in 1883. Type II (1903 1941 Issue). In silver gilt, two eagles in white enamel, obverse centre shows royal cipher, reverse center shows inscription 1882, inclusive of its crown and ball suspension 66. 7 mm (h) x 34. 2 mm (w), very fine condition. Footnote: The Order was instituted 23rd January 1883 by King Milan I of Serbia. In the period between 1883 and 1898 Order of the White Eagle was the highest award in the Kingdom of Serbia.
